自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

feinifi的博客

never stand still

  • 博客(9)
  • 资源 (7)
  • 收藏
  • 关注

原创 centos7下安装单机版kubernetes实战

kubernetes是docker分布式解决方案,是当前最火的docker解决方案,一般初学者适合玩单机安装。kubernetes安装很简单,只需要通过yum安装etcd,kubernetes即可。默认kubernetes会有etcd,docker,kube-apiserver,kube-controller-manager,kube-scheduler,kubelet,kube-prox...

2019-11-25 09:09:52 2473 1

原创 centos7下安装gitlab-ci持续集成实战

gitlab提供了ci/cd持续集成/持续部署的功能,当我们安装了gitlab之后,需要单独再安装gitlab-ci-multi-runner,其实就是gitlab-runner,为了试验,我们一次性安装gitlab,gitlab-ci-multi-runner,在centos7下他们需要单独的安装源,可以使用清华的gitlab-ce与gitlab-ci-multi-runner源,如下所...

2019-11-22 15:52:04 1148

原创 二分查找算法介绍

二分查找算法的实现过程如下:在排序数组中查找某一个数据项,首先让待查数据与中间下标元素开始比较,如果相等则返回,如果小于中间下标元素,重新开始从低位开始,(中间下标-1)结束的数组内,继续执行相同的查找操作,如果大于中间下标元素,重新开始从中间下标+1,高位结束的数组内,继续执行相同的查找操作,直到低位超过高位,如果没有找到,返回-1,如果找到,则返回对应的中间下标。因为每次执行一次查询操...

2019-11-18 14:52:44 1237

原创 C++实现简单链表

链表是最常用的一种数据结构,无论什么语言,学习数据结构,都绕不开链表,下面通过c++来实现简单链表,所谓简单链表,就是构建链表,然后遍历打印链表。 c++中构建链表,最简单的是使用结构体来定义节点,节点定义很简单:节点数据,下一个节点,这就是链表的全部,另外,为了通过new的时候,直接创建一个节点,我们可以通过定义一个带参数的构造函数来实现。 链表结构体定义如下:...

2019-11-13 16:04:16 11063

原创 springboot与flyway集成做数据迁移

flyway是一种用来做数据迁移的框架,如果你的项目不是jpa+hibenate,比如使用的mybatis,那么你需要在实体创建之前,在数据库中生成表结构,然后逆向工程,生成实体,或者自己编码写实体类,部署的时候,需要将测试环境的表结构和部分数据导出为sql文件,部署到生产环境中,全程操作数据库都是人为操作。后续实体发生改变,字段增减,还需要单独运行一个增量的脚本,或者全量更新,这还需要人...

2019-11-11 23:38:37 1162

原创 netty实现http客户端请求远程http服务

一般http请求,我们会使用httpclient来实现连接池方式的连接,根据请求的类型,封装get,post等请求,设置参数,设置请求头,调用方法,发送请求之后等待请求返回结果,根据结果解析出我们需要的数据。netty也可以实现httpclient类似的功能,只不过,很多时候,我们使用netty构建tcp的连接,要么使用netty构建http服务端,很少用来构建http客户端,其实和tcp...

2019-11-08 23:43:42 13797 10

原创 windows下telnet回显解决办法

telnet相信大家都用过,在tcp连接中,我们可以用来模拟发送客户端请求,当我们输入telnet 127.0.0.1 8888连接本机的tcp 8888端口时,连接成功后,会进入一个输入模式,一般默认当我们在这里输入信息并回车,控制台不会显示我们的输入信息,只能在服务端才能看到内容。如下所示: 输入内容,不显示,服务端会显示: 解决办法:同时...

2019-11-07 14:03:33 5028

原创 docker启动报错:standard_init_linux.go:211: exec user process caused "no such file or directory"

如题所示,根据自己构建的镜像启动docker容器,直接退出,查看容器日志报错信息,没有任何别的信息。网上搜索这个问题,发现很多人都遇到过,解决办法也各不相同,最后发现一篇文章。受到启发,我的项目是java项目,通过ENTRYPOINT命令启动脚本docker-entrypoint.sh来构建一个在后台运行的服务。而我的docker-entrypoint.sh是在windows下编辑的,自...

2019-11-05 10:21:01 38469 2

原创 truffle构建以太坊应用并测试第一个helloworld智能合约

最近因为国家对区块链又重视起来了,相信今年年底到明年年初会是一个区块链的新的爆发点,也是碰巧学习了一下以太坊构建区块链应用,以前都是简单的了解,并没有实际动手演练。今天趁机会也学习一下区块链,同时也学习了几个新名词。比如账户,私钥,智能合约(smart contract),编译合约(compile),迁移合约(migrate),测试合约(test)。 truffle是一个no...

2019-11-02 23:47:49 1028 5

Monaco-font.zip

Monaco字体是一款mac系统默认的字体,可以在windows上安装,喜欢这款字体的可以下载。 1、下载之后,可以直接打开,然后点击界面上的安装字体,就可以将字体安装到C:\Windows\Fonts目录下 2、也可以直接将下载的字体文件MONACO.TTF文件放入C:\Windows\Fonts文件夹下。

2019-10-23

xftp6绿色版

配合xshell6快速传输资源,只要与linux服务器连接上,速度优于lrzsz传输。

2019-01-11

linux下rustup安装可执行文件

centos7下可以通过该工具来安装指定版本的rust,eg:path/to/rustup install nightly-2018-01-12

2018-03-23

jmxtools.jar jmxri.jar

jmx依赖包,官方已经不提供了,这里给2分,给大家下载。

2018-01-24

mysql主从复制环境搭建(Fedora20)

mysql主从复制 两台虚拟机Fedora20 安装相同版本(mysql-community版) 配置hosts 配置主从关系 配置bin-log日志

2016-08-23

在桌面程序的选项面板里找到选中的面板

如何在选项面板以及双层选项面板里找到当前选择的面板,通过分层拨开。

2010-11-03

Java调用批处理示例

Java调用批处理,以及需要注意的地方,多使用,可以增强编程与windows服务的知识

2010-11-03

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除